Others
These are the characters who are playing fairly small roles, so they don't get a full
page to themselve, unless their roles expand in some way. Note that, due to the way
I tinker with the plot, some of the details may change without warning.
| King Edward Aphroa |
|
Age: 43
The king of Aphroa and Amelia and Karista's father. He was once a
feared warrior on the battlefield, which is how he received the nickname "Edward the
Bear." He loved his wife Kasha deeply, and received her love back tenfold, and after her
death began to withdraw into himself. Amelia became his only connection to reality.
However, despite his mournful demeanor, his skill as a warrior has not rusted, even
if his time spent fighting has greatly decreased.
|
| Queen Kasha Aphroa |
|
Age: 23(At time of death)
The late queen of Aphroa, and Amelia and Karista's mother. Very little
about her is known by the citizens of Aphroa, since her origins were purposely hidden by
Edward, who feared that his people would not accept her or their children if it became known
that she was born outside the mountains, due to the long war with the people who lived there
(Called Outsiders). She possessed a very headstrong spirit, which was not always apparent from
her regal bearings. She died of a mysterious illness (which, as Jacob revealed in Chapter 3,
only affected Outsiders; it had been long forgotten by most people of the mountains) while
giving birth to her twin daughters (whom she named herself), but in her last words, she
vowed to always watch over her children...
|
| Aron Sebenda |
|
Age: 26 (At time of death)
Michael's late father. A very well-known warrior with a reputation rivalling Edward's and a
long family history of serving Aphroa as a Sword Mage, he was a knight who's only weakness was
his love for his wife, Maria, and his son. Many stories are told of his brave deeds, but after the
death of his wife, he felt responsible because he was fighting in the war when she died. Aron
lay down his sword and vowed to never fight again, but soon afterwards, he tried to raise Michael
to carry on the family name and become a knight as well. However, three years following his
wife's death, Aron suddenly picked up his sword and left without saying where he was going. He
was later found near the border of Diteea, dead, covered in blood, dying on the battlefield
that had earned him his fame, having fought a battle that nobody even knew if he had won or lost.
|
| Maria Sebenda |
|
Age: 23 (At time of death)
Michael's late mother. She had been frail since birth and always sick. However, she had a
very fragile beauty and pure spirit that captivated Aron, and she admired his chivalristic
way of life, and they married when Maria was only 17. Maria lived her life loving both him
and her son, and never regretted even the fact that her husband was often away at battle.
She finally died at age 23, after a long battle with consumption.
|
| King Medias Diteea |
|
Age: 50
Medias, in his younger days, fought in many Outsider wars. Despite his strong magic abilities,
he often felt more comfortable using his sword. He has grown up with an intense hatred for
Outsiders, and while he doesn't quarrel often with King Edward, he thinks of him as weak for
not participating in as many conflicts and would rather they band together and eliminate the
people living close to the border mountains on the outside of the ring. He has tried to
ingrain this philosophy into his children, but with mild success. His sentiments, while echoed
by many in Diteea in particular, are beginning to fade. In the meantime, he has also tried
to groom his eldest son for the throne.
|
| Queen Raina Diteea |
|
Age: 48
Raina, in contrast to her husband, is not nearly as extreme. She is a strict disciplinarian
of her children, particularly Wynn, but is also quick to lend an ear. However, she tends to
pay more attention to Wynn, as he is the eldest and the crown prince, which means she'll dote
on him more, but also punish him harder. She does care deeply for her other children, but she
often feels pressure that Wynn be a great ruler and not disgrace her or the Diteean family
(she married into it).
|
| Crown Prince Wynn Diteea |
|
Age: 30
Wynn is extremely care-free, almost irresponsible, and has a reputation for being a womanizer.
He's never seen with the same girl twice, much to his mother's chagrin. Some of this may
be due to the pressure on him to be the ideal ruler when he inherits the kingdom. Wynn
is successful in battle (he's skilled with both mid-level magic and swordplay), but seems to
look at life as a game. His time on the battlefield and his interactions with those he has
fought, however, have started to confuse him over his true purpose for fighting. Wynn does
try to look out for Teran when they have time together, and tends to kid him for being
so serious, but his relationship with Bara is practically frozen.
|
| Princess Bara Diteea |
|
Age: 25
Bara is extremely withdrawn. She has always been very shy, but about seven years ago, she
suddenly isolated herself from everyone, including her family. Until then, she and Teran
had a very close relationship. Rumors say that she was unlucky in love, which did nothing
to help her fragile ego. There are other, more frightening rumors, about what she does in
her isolation, though publicly, she is just known to read and practice her magic. She is
the most powerful sorceress in the mountains and rivals Doren as the most powerful magic
user.
|
| Tomue and Shurika
Ages: ??
Tomue and his sister Shurika were a pair of Dark Elf (Drow) assassins that were dispatched
to kill Amelia, Karista, Jacob, and Michael. Being Dark Elves in this story, however,
as Meagan once said, they had the lifespans (and success) of Stormtroopers. Needless
to say, they're no longer among the living.
|
| Mysterious Wizard |
|
Age: ??
This wizard's role is a mystery. He seems involved with Teran's imprisonment and relishes
in watching the suffering of others. But what is his connection to Doren?
